Web11 apr. 2024 · The Prickly Pear. Opuntia, commonly known as the prickly pear, is a genus of flowering cacti in the family Cactaceae. The prickly pear may also be called the Indian fig opuntia, nopal cactus, sabra, and tuna (used to refer to the fruit). The most common species that is used for culinary purposes is O. ficus-indica, or the Indian fig opuntia. Web26 nov. 2024 · Chances are you’ve seen a purple cactus floating about that looks almost identical to the prickly pear aside from coloring. That’s because it’s an Opuntia macrocentra (or purple prickly pear).
